Causing physical harm to others

Alcohol is one of the most common drugs abused in the entire state of Colorado. It is the drug of choice for most teens that are addicted. Drunk drivers are responsible for the physical harm and death of thousands every year. The threat that these drivers provide affects everyone that is on the road with them.

Damage to business reputation

Businesses that hire people who suffer from drug abuse often feel the effects. They, in some case, experience damaged reputations as a result of these employees. In other cases, the damage may cause a reduction in profits for the business. Construction workers and food service workers are some of the top fields of drug abusers in the workplace.

Health concerns burden society

Drug abuse is responsible for many of the health concerns that users experience. The Rocky Mountain Poison and Control Center, in Colorado, reports that cocaine is a serious problem in the state. It is responsible for the most emergency room visits, drug-related discharges, and mortality rates per 100,000 of the population. Medication costs for drug users tend to be 2 times that of a normal person. Drug abuse continues to make The War on Drugs relevant in this state.
